View Issue Details
ID | Project | Category | View Status | Date Submitted | Last Update |
---|---|---|---|---|---|
0018105 | MMW 5 | Main Panel: Toolbars & Menus | public | 2021-07-03 15:10 | 2021-07-07 21:38 |
Reporter | lowlander | Assigned To | |||
Priority | urgent | Severity | minor | Reproducibility | random |
Status | closed | Resolution | reopened | ||
Product Version | 5.0.1 | ||||
Target Version | 5.1 | Fixed in Version | 5.0.1 | ||
Summary | 0018105: Using Hidden Main Menu can cause main/context menus to become unresponsive [Regression] | ||||
Description | Using Hidden Main Menu can cause main/context menus to become unresponsive. Observed the Main Menu, File Context and Tray Icon Context become unresponsive to input. MediaMonkey itself did remain responsive. | ||||
Steps To Reproduce | 1 Make sure the Main Menu is hidden 2 Use Alt+V --> A Observed root menu becoming unresponsive to user input (in this state other context menus were also unresponsive to user input) --> B Observed sub-menu's becoming unresponsive to user input To get condition A you may have to first use a Alt alone a few times to reveal the Main Menu, after that Alt+V may cause condition A. | ||||
Tags | No tags attached. | ||||
Fixed in build | 2422 | ||||
|
It's easier to reproduce: - disable Menu bar - use Alt key to show and hide menu without any user interaction - next time use Alt to show menu again and it's unresponsible for some unknown reason forwarding Alt key to the browser makes window unresponsible to user input. I didn't found a way how to fix it now. Anyhow i think this issue isn't critical as menu MUST be hidden using Alt key (simply Alt or Alt with any key) and menu bar must be disabled (it's not by default). |
|
I can confirm 0018105:0064163. Essential is that there is no Mouse event between Show and Hide Menu when using ALT eg. quickly double tap ALT and do not move mouse. If you circle mouse while Open Hide Menu all is working. Also noted that when menu gets unresponsive it takes a long time that MM tray icon disappear. |
|
This problem isn't present in build 2338. |
|
I'm 99% sure it's chromium bug |
|
We've found a workaround. Fixed. |
|
Workaround caused another regressions so reverted. |
|
Another workaround applied in 2422 |
|
Hmm, re-opned, this bug can still occur when Alt key is down |
|
Fixed in 2422 by another (hopefully final) workaround for the Chromium bug |
|
Verified 2422. |